– Former WWE NXT talent Shaun Ricker, who was on The Rock’s “Hero” reality TV show, is booked for this week’s TNA TV tapings in Orlando. Ricker previously worked TNA’s One Night Only tapings.
– Bob Ryder revealed on Twitter that he had meetings on Tuesday to bring TNA live events back on the road.

– John Gaburick announced today that Angelina Love has signed a new deal with TNA.
